Borrowings
Borrowings
The Company had $39.1 million and $39.0 million of outstanding debt, net of debt discounts, as of June 30, 2019 and December 31, 2018, respectively. The outstanding debt is related to a term loan entered by the Company with Biopharma Credit Investments IV Sub LP, or Pharmakon, in October 2017 for total loan proceeds of $40.0 million. The total debt issuance costs of $1.3 million were recorded as a direct deduction from the carrying amount of the term loan on the consolidated balance sheet, and are being amortized over the period of the term loan using the effective interest method to interest expense in the consolidated statement of operations. The term loan includes an interest-only period for 35 months through September 2020 and is then repaid in equal quarterly principal payments plus interest through December 2022, and is classified as long-term borrowings on the consolidated balance sheet. The term loan carries a fixed interest rate of 11.5% and a closing fee of 1.5% of the funded amount, or $0.6 million. The term loan includes a pre-payment fee equal to the remaining interest due for the first 30 months of the agreement if it is prepaid within the first 30 months, a 2% prepayment penalty for months 31-48, and a 1% penalty for months 49-60. The term loan requires the Company to maintain a minimum cash balance of $5.0 million and beginning with the three months ended March 31, 2019, the Company is required to meet either minimum net sales or trailing 12-month consolidated EBITDA targets as discussed in detail in Note 7 of Notes to Consolidated Financial Statements in the Annual Report on Form 10-K filed with the SEC on March 14, 2019. The loan is a senior obligation secured with a blanket first lien on the assets of the Company. The effective interest rate for the three months ended June 30, 2019 and 2018 was 12.3% and for the six months ended June 30, 2019 and 2018 was 12.2%. The Company was in compliance with all debt covenants as of June 30, 2019.
